Buffalo Bites looks like it should be a theme camp at Burning Man. The unfinished looking kitchen structure, the arching steel shade structure, the fluttering flags, and the mismatched outdoor seating all seem out of place anywhere but in the black rock desert. To find such a thing in Ketchum, Idaho was so shocking I had to eat there, no matter what was on the menu.
They specialize in...wait for it...buffalo! Roast buffalo sandwiches instead of roast beef, buffalo ham, you get the point. I'm not sure if it is buffalo, or how they prepare it, but the first sandwich I had from them featured dry meat. Almost a year later, to the day, and I found the same challenge. The presentation is great, the other ingredients faboo, and the overall taste is delicious. But the meat is a little...dry. Maybe next time I'll try something other than the roast buffalo.
The staff is friendly, but they are not prepared for children's needs (read: no ketchup). All of that, and they still get four stars? The setting is fabulous, the people who work there are really helpful, and they have local guide books to read, including a guide to some great hikes in and around Ketchum.
Tip of the day: if the front patio is crowded, head to the *very hidden* back patio, where there is a fountain and even more seating. -

I passed by Buffalo Bites when I was stopping over at Chateau Drug and Atkinson's Market, and I thought it looked so cute. I don't know what happens in the winter, but there is great patio seating out front with large umbrellas providing shade. I had hoped that everything on the menu would be buffalo, but luckily (I think - I've never actually had buffalo), there was a pretty good selection at this tiny restaurant. The restaurant had soup (cold gazpacho and warm soups), sandwiches, salads and panini sandwiches made from local, fresh ingredients (always a big plus). I was trying to decide between the ham sandwich and the buffalo sirloin, and I ordered the ham sandwich while managing to change everything about it - no dijon mustard, swap out the Swiss cheese for Guyrere. This was probably one of the best ham sandwiches I've had in a long time - the ham was thinly sliced but not so thin that it tastes like Oscar Meyer deli meat, and the bread, particularly the crust, was so delicious. The sandwich came with a small serving of more carbs (pasta salad with sun dried tomatoes). The sandwich was definitely on the expensive side ($10), but this is Sun Valley...
